Dear Friends & Family,    12 July 08, Northern California, USA

USA!?!  When we last left you we were thinking of sailing back across the Indian Ocean & flying back to the US from Malaysia.  Luckily, sanity prevailed at the last moment - & I mean the very last moment.  We'd already checked out of South Africa - a LONG process, involving 6 different offices & much officialdom.  We were all provisioned for 2 months at sea when we realized that we'd be at sea for all of July & most of August, probably the best months in the Pacific Northwest.  Silly in the extreme!

So we checked back into South Africa(!) & bought tickets to San Francisco (via Durban, Jo'burg & Paris), rediscovering the joys of locking oneself in a screaming metal can for hours on end.  Since landing we've reconnected with Jon's Dad (who has loaned us a nice car) in the San Francisco Bay Area.

California in the summer is always delightful, with long conversations over lazy meals, catching up with friends & family.  We got to spend a day in San Francisco proper, a wonderfully nostalgic trip.  We've been berry picking, picnicking, & enjoying all the temperate fresh fruits & veggies we can get our hands on.

We're now driving up to the Seattle area.  On the way, we spent 3 days in the Sierra Nevada Mountains, getting the granite-mountain fix we've been craving.  A friend loaned us his mountain cabin from which we staged day hikes past countless blue lakes set like jewels in the fields of yellow, lavender and white wild-flowers.  We trekked through grasslands & ancient forests of the high-country (9,000 feet, or 2,800 meters), all presided over by glacier-polished granite mountains, still highlighted
with patchy snow-fields.  After so long at sea-level, the fragrant air was positively intoxicating.

Our current plans (as always, set firmly in custard) are to stay in the Seattle are until mid-October.  Until then, we'll be getting Amanda settled into the University of Washington (Oceanography) & trying to reconnect with as many friends as we can.  Since our house is still rented out, we'll be couch-surfing much of the time.  If anyone has a house that needs taking care of this summer, please let us know.

By about mid-October we're scheduled to drive back to San Francisco & fly back to Ocelot in South Africa.  A few weeks to get her ship-shape again & we'll head down the coast towards Cape Town, hopefully in time for Xmas.  We'd like to start our Atlantic crossing in January, heading for tiny St. Helena Island.  At least, that's the plan today...
